how do i use fsolve to solve a stream function ?
2 ビュー (過去 30 日間)
古いコメントを表示
I have a stream function and am asked to solve it numerically to
calculate velocity at the x and y co-ordinates and then plot the pressure
co-efficient on a rankin oval. But am unsure of how to use the fsolve function to
solve the stream function .
the code i have so far:
syms U0 x y real
psi = U0*y + 4/2/pi * atan2(y, x+1) - 4/2/pi * atan2 (y, x-1);
v=-diff(psi, x)
u=diff(psi, y)
U0=1
x=-3:0.01:3;
y=-3:0.01:3;
u=eval(u)
v=eval(v)
any help is appreciated.

Why you need to "solve" the stream function since it is already there? There's nothing to solve. Most likely what was meant was discretize/numeric calculate it, and your code seems fine so far.
